Fifth Third Bancorp (FITB) is trading at $50.76 as of May 1, 2026, posting a single-session gain of 1.95% amid mixed momentum across the U.S. regional banking sector. This analysis outlines key technical levels, recent market context, and potential scenarios for the stock in upcoming trading sessions, with a focus on observable price action and sector trends rather than speculative forecasts.
